Description
This syringe has been design exclusively for dental application. It ser-
ves to inject air and water, separated or as spray at room temperature.
Commissioning and use
Only use instruments in perfect operating condition. Immediately stop
any work if intermittences or other signs of instrument failure occur.
Injecting cold water: press left button on the handhold.
Injecting cold air: press right button on the handhold.
Injecting cold water-air-mixture (spray): simultaneously press both but-
tons at the syringe head.
Cleaning and sterilizing
Clean and sterilize the case and the cannula before using it on the
next patient. Remove the cannula by pulling and/or remove the entire
case by loosening the case and unscrewing the plug nipples.
Sterilization occurs in an autoclave at 134°C.
Disinfection
For disinfection use a clean damp cloth and disinfect the case surface.
Only use disinfectants recommended by the manufacturer.
Never submerge the device in a disinfectant solution.
Do not insert the device into an ultrasonic bath.
Maintenance
No specific maintenance procedures are intended for this devise.
Under any circumstances avoid using any lubricants as this my cause
irreparable damage to syringe.
